Challenge

Prediabetes means a person's blood sugar level is higher than normal, but not high enough to be diagnosed with diabetes. We see a critical need to address the high rates of type 2 diabetes. Limited health literacy hinders informed choices about nutrition, exercise, behavioural and preventative measures.

Solution

Our program empowers participants to take charge of their health with a) Weekly newsletters via email and or text, for 9 months which contain educational videos and information on monthly interactive workshops and support groups, both with small 6 person breakout rooms that allow participants to connect and share their stories and progress with and get to know each other.

Long-Term Impact

With a successful "Preventing Type 2 Diabetes with Health Literacy" program, we can expect more empowered participants with improved health outcomes. Participants will gain knowledge and skills to manage stress, eat healthier, and prevent diabetes. This can lead to a decrease in diagnoses, reducing healthcare burden and improving overall well-being.
